I’d like to see direct support for wearables such as the Apple Watch. Obviously not expecting all the features that Ooma has, but at least basic functionality to handle phone calls and voicemail capabilities. I don’t believe Ooma should be depending on a third party (IFTT) to provide this service. First, phone features exist through Apple, so the capability exists. Second, extra parties involved increase opportunities for service failure, and also requires additional account(s) and introduce unnecessary policy/privacy concerns.

Wearables are here and growing and, IMO, Ooma needs to directly support them.

Can't you go to myooma and go to Preferences > Call Forwarding and select to ring your iPhone number and set to always?

All calls will then be forwarded to your watch in addition to your Telo (if you want).

Of course you can't initiate ooma calls, but at least can receive them.
